Kenya  ESSENCE OF A CONTINENT SAFARI | 12 DAYS · CUSTOM

O ur meticulously crafted Essence of a Continent joyfully exhibits what Shakespeare called “Africa’s golden joys,” taking us off the too-trod path to some of the country’s finest and vastest wildlife reserves. We begin in the south, flying from Nairobi to Hemingway’s Green Hills of Africa, the Chyulu, for two nights at the incomparable Campi ya Kanzi, gazing out at nearby Kilimanjaro as we game view and hike in the Chyulu’s mystically entrancing cloud forest. Next we fly from ya Kanzi to the Masai Mara—the Serengeti’s northern component—and the lovely Serian Camp, one of East Africa’s supreme permanent tented camps, for another experience of the country’s essence; we peacefully track game with Maasai guides (getting to know these amazing folk) and enjoy sun- downers in camp, listening for the thunder-clap roar of lions in the bush. Winging our way to the Mathews Range, we spend two nights at Sarara, a captivating conservation-oriented camp in the realm of leopard, reticulated giraffe, elephant, and kudu. We end with a leisurely three days in the Northern Frontier District, an extraordinarily wildlife-rich area in the shadow of peacockish Mount Kenya.
